What is a Smart Plug?
A smart plug, sometimes referred to as a smart socket or Wi-Fi plug, is a device that fits into a standard electrical outlet, allowing you to control whatever is plugged into it using a smartphone app or voice commands. It essentially grants “smart” capabilities to any non-smart appliance, from lamps and fans to coffee makers and humidifiers.

How Smart Plugs Work
Govee Smart Plugs operate by connecting to your home’s Wi-Fi network (specifically 2.4GHz, as 5GHz networks are not supported) and often include Bluetooth for a more stable initial setup or direct control. Once connected, the Govee Home App on your smartphone becomes your central command center. This app allows you to remotely switch the power on or off, set schedules, and access advanced features. The plug acts as a controlled gatekeeper for electricity, responding to your commands sent via the app or integrated voice assistants like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ant.
Benefits of Using Smart Plugs
The advantages of incorporating Govee Smart Plugs into your home are numerous, enhancing both convenience and efficiency.
- Energy Monitoring: One of Govee Smart Plugs’ most compelling features is real-time energy monitoring. This allows you to track power, current, voltage, and accumulated energy consumption (kWh) over various periods—daily, weekly, monthly, and even up to a year. Understanding which devices are energy hogs can empower you to make smarter choices and reduce your electricity bills.
- Remote Control of Devices: Forget worrying if you left the curling iron on. With the Govee Home App, you can turn devices on or off from anywhere, whether you’re at work, on vacation, or simply in another room.
- Automated Scheduling: Set precise schedules for your appliances. Have your coffee maker start brewing before you wake up, or ensure your Christmas lights turn on and off automatically at sunset and sunrise. This creates a predictable and convenient home environment.
- Enhanced Home Security: Smart plugs can deter potential intruders by creating the illusion that someone is home. Schedule lights to turn on and off randomly when you’re away, making your home appear occupied.
- Seamless Smart Home Integration: Govee Smart Plugs integrate smoothly with popular voice assistants like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ant, enabling hands-free control. This allows you to weave them into broader smart home routines alongside other connected devices.

Govee Smart Plug Setup and Usage Guide
Setting up and using your Govee Smart Plug is designed to be a straightforward process, even for those new to smart home technology.
Basic Installation Steps
Getting your Govee Smart Plug up and running takes just a few minutes:
- Download the Govee Home App: Search for “Govee Home” in your smartphone’s app store (iOS or Android) and install it.
- Create an Account: Open the app and register for a new account or log in.
- Plug in the Smart Plug: Insert your Govee Smart Plug into a standard wall outlet. Ensure the outlet is functioning.
- Add Device in App: Open the Govee Home App, tap the “+” icon in the top right corner, and select “Smart Plug” from the device list. Follow the on-screen prompts to connect the plug to your 2.4GHz Wi-Fi network. Remember, 5GHz Wi-Fi is not supported.
- Rename the Device (Optional): Once connected, rename the smart plug in the app for easy identification (e.g., “Living Room Lamp,” “Coffee Maker”).

Frequently Asked Questions
What kind of Wi-Fi network does a Govee Smart Plug connect to?
Govee Smart Plugs require a 2.4GHz Wi-Fi network for connection. They do not support 5GHz Wi-Fi networks, so ensure your router is configured to broadcast a 2.4GHz signal or has dual-band capabilities.
Can I control my Govee Smart Plug when I’m away from home?
Yes, absolutely. As long as your Govee Smart Plug is connected to your home’s 2.4GHz Wi-Fi network and your smartphone has an internet connection, you can control your devices remotely using the Govee Home App from anywhere in the world.
Do Govee Smart Plugs work with voice assistants?
Yes, Govee Smart Plugs are compatible with both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ant. After connecting your smart plug to the Govee Home App, you can link your Govee account in the respective voice assistant app to enable hands-free voice control for your connected devices.
